Troubleshooting
Safety
Fault diagnosis Make a note of the serial number and configuration of the device and contact our After-
Sales Service team with a detailed description of the error, if
- errors occur that are not listed below
- the troubleshooting measures listed are unsuccessful
Power source has no function
Mains switch is on, but indicators are not lit up
Cause: There is a break in the mains lead; the mains plug is not plugged in
Remedy: Check the mains lead, ensure that the mains plug is plugged in
Cause: Mains socket or mains plug faulty
Remedy: Replace faulty parts
Cause: Mains fuse protection
Remedy: Change the mains fuse protection
No response after setting a welding start signal
Mains switch is ON and indicators are lit up
Cause: Welding torch or welding torch control line is faulty
Remedy: Replace the welding torch
Cause: Interconnecting hosepack is faulty or not connected properly
Remedy: Check interconnecting hosepack
WARNING! Work that is carried out incorrectly can cause serious injury or dam-
age. All the work described below must only be carried out by trained and quali-
fied personnel. Do not carry out any of the work described below until you have
fully read and understood the following documents:
- this document
- all the operating instructions for the system components, especially the safe-
ty rules
WARNING! An electric shock can be fatal. Before starting the work described be-
low:
- turn the power source mains switch to the "O" position
- disconnect the power source from the mains
- ensure that the power source remains disconnected from the mains until all
work has been completed
After opening the device, use a suitable measuring instrument to check that elec-
trically charged components (e.g. capacitors) have been discharged.
CAUTION! Risk of scalding by hot system components. Before starting work, al-
low all hot system components to cool down to room temperature (+25 °C, +77
°F). For example:
- coolant
- water-cooled system components
- wire-feed unit drive motor
